The Spirit of Normandy Trust organised their annual ceremony at ‘Monty’s’ statue. This year, two British veterans, Ken Hay and Henry Rice, were present, making the pilgrimage to the battle grounds of Normandy. Ken Hay spoke about seeing the names on the memorial and being able to remember the faces.
Henry David Montgomery, 3rd Viscount Montgomery of Alamein gave a speech together with representatives of the region. There was a strong presence from the British Armed Forces, including the Air Cadets and members of the Gurkha Regiment. It was really moving to see the veterans lay their wreaths and to experience the warm support of the public.
I led the hymns and anthems and sang with Jedburgh Pipe Band during the ceremony.
